Curriculum vitae,
or CVs, as these documents are also known, have widespread use overseas, where they are
preferred to resumes.
In the United
States, however, resumes are most often used. That
said, CVs are warranted under the following conditions:

The
candidate has been published numerous times and has made many presentations, with details
of these included in the document.

Length: Whereas resumes rarely exceed two pages in length,
CVs can run from 10 to 15 pages and longer.
Again, generally
speaking, a resume is preferred over a CV in the United States, unless the hiring
authority specifically requests a CV.
